Model Numbers and Phone Frequencies:

  • Checking Frequency (to identify model)

  • Press: *99982* OK (or checkmark)

    • 2g4 = Model 7440 (2G4 - The North American legacy DECT variant operating in the 2.4 GHz frequency band)

    • 1g9 = Model 7449 (1G9 - The North American DECT variant operating in the 1920 - 1930 MHz frequency band)

Additional Handset commands/tools:

  • Look up IPEI/Serial #

    • Press: *99984* OK (or checkmark) - 12 digit number is IPEI

  • Activating Signal Meter Mode

    1. Turn the wireless handsets on

    2. Dial *99989* (Note: Make sure that "Key Lock" is not active - to turn off Key Lock, Press: Menu *

    3. Press OK (checkmark) - The Signal Meter Display will appear

    • Turning Off Signal Meter Display

      • Press and hold the < key for 2 seconds - the wireless handset will return to the idle condition

DMC320 Base Station Wiring

RJ45 Connector 1

pin 4&5 = w/bl = base 1

pin 1&2 = w/gr = base 2

pin 3&8 = w/or = base 3

pin 7&8 = w/br = base 4

RJ45 Connector 2

pin 4&5 = w/bl = base 5

pin 1&2 = w/gr = base 6

pin 3&8 = w/or = base 7

pin 7&8 = w/br = base 8
